Requirements: Grade 12 Certificate plus B Degree/B-tech Degree in Public Relations, Media Liaison/Journalism (NQFLEVEL 7 as recognized by SAQA) plus work experience in the related field, of which 5 years’ experience should be in Middle Management (Communication). A valid driver’s license.
The requirements for appointment at the Senior Management Service level include the successful completion of the Senior Management Pre-entry Programme (Nyukela-Certificate) as endorsed by the National School of Government. Applicants should therefore have proof that they have registered for the Pre-entry Certificate, which can be accessed using the following link: https://www.thensg.gov.za/training-course/sms-pre-entry.
DUTIES
Manage media liaison and monitoring services. Coordinate and monitor radio talk shows. Coordinate a live-streaming event. Manage community liaison and event management services. Manage the branding of the department.
Manage internal communication, production, and Publication services. Manage and coordinate the provision of printing services.
Manage and Coordinate the publication of internal newsletters. Management of risks, budget, expenditure, human resources, strategic planning, and audit issues.
